CEL light and engine is running rich.
installed number 1 headers also have number one catback exhaust. the exhaust has no cat and obviously neither does the header. i was reading that the antifouler doesnt really workand i have no cat to relocate the o2 bung behind. so i dont know what to do...ik the car is running rich because you can smell it when you get behind the car....and ive had like 8 people smell it and they all agree. ne helpful tips?
X2. No cat = stink.
If you were running rich, and you're probably not, you'd throw a fault code for it. You probably have just a P0420 code now which is what the anti-fouler will (more often than not) prevent.

no if u read more into it on the forums basically they say get two foulers...drill a 1/2 inch hole in the first one then screw the second one into the first...then screw it all into the o2 bung. sounds simple to me https://www.scionlife.com/forums/viewtopic.php?t=101069
wow that was so easy to do. i bought the 42002 spark plug antifouls...drilled the 1/2 inch hole and to be honest it wasnt even that straight....still tightened right up and now no cel light
